Transaction d529028e4f63cfe60bb566289e3b4fc303c45ce9da62159ad2b3726018a44b2c
1 Input
1 Output
-
d529028e4f63cfe60bb566289e3b4fc303c45ce9da62159ad2b3726018a44b2c:0
- value
- 307581
- script pubkey
- OP_0 OP_PUSHBYTES_32 172855c0046c70a6934bc64a4fb779261d7d506005b89bb974bb3bee9967ef11
- address
- bc1qzu59tsqyd3c2dy6tce9yldmeycwh65rqqkufhwt5hva7axt8augsq43zmm